Advance your career at Liberty Mutual Insurance- A Fortune 100 Company!  When you enter a Corporate Treasury position at Liberty Mutual Insurance, you'll find the same dynamic environment and challenges as within other organizations. Yet you'll find something more: an opportunity to apply your analytical and technical skills to a company renowned for its integrity and focus on developing its employees' careers.   In this role, you will participate in and manage complex financial analysis reports and projects. Using a broad knowledge of financial practices and procedures, you will provide strategy recommendations to management.
Responsibilities:
    • Under guidance, executes daily financial decisions, administration functions and metric compilation.
    • Under guidance supports financial and operational planning. Identifies and works to help resolve issues as they arise.
    • Responsible for ad-hoc reporting and analysis, executing financial controls, and actively participates in department and / or cross functional projects of low scope. Uses data driven decision making in projects and continuous improvement recommendations.
    • Interact with banking partners, internal Treasury departments and Strategic Business units

Qualifications:

  • 0-2 years of professional experience
  • Bachelor's degree with a minimum 3.0 cumulative GPA. Additional requirements might apply
  • Must have permanent work authorization in the United States
  • Bachelor's degree in Finance and/or Accounting
  • Attention to detail in a fast-paced work environment, and the ability to manage and prioritize multiple projects simultaneously
  • Strong interpersonal, communication (both verbal and written), organizational and leadership skills
  • Experience with technical programs including MS Office Suite and a strong working knowledge of Excel
